Spree runs only with rear brake applied....Help
A change of subject was needed and the old topic buried. If I let go of the rear brake after my spree starts it will quit. I am quite sure this is an electrical issue. Does the kickstand need to be up? Is there a switch that needs to be adjusted? Can I just disable needing the brake to start?
